Microscopic investigation on reaction products in relation to strength development
The stabilized soil sample SCM30, which had the optimum determined content of RHA replacement, was selected for further micro analysis of the reaction products compared with SCM00. The XRD analysis pattern of the stabilized soil is shown in Figure 6 for SCM00 and in Figure 7 for SCM30. Figure 6 identifies that the stabilized soil SCM00 consisted of the
reaction products calcium silicate hydrate (CSH), calcium hydroxide (CH), tri-calcium silicate hydrate (C3S), di-calcium silicate hydrate (C2S) together with a silica form as quartz (Qzt) and clay minerals content such as montmorilonite (Mont),
illite (Ilt) and kaolinite (Kao). It was found that the formation of the main products of the hydration reaction process (CSH and CH) increased with an increase in curing time while the formation of C3S and C2S gradually decreased with time. A
